WHAT IS WEB DEVELOPMENT?
Web development involves creating and maintaining websites or web applications, covering various skills such as front-end development (user interface and user experience), back-end development (server-side scripting, databases), and occasionally full-stack development (both front-end and back-end).
HOW TO BECOME WEB DEVELOPER ?
To become a web developer Follow this steps :-
1. Learn the Basics:
- Begin with HTML for structuring web content.
- Acquire skills in CSS for styling and layout.
- Master JavaScript for interactivity and dynamic content.
2. Understand Responsive Design:
- Learn techniques to make websites responsive for different screen sizes.
3. Learn a Front-End Framework:
- Familiarize yourself with front-end frameworks like React, Angular, or Vue.js.
4. Back-End Development:
- Learn a server-side language such as Node.js (JavaScript), Python, Ruby, PHP, or Java.
- Understand databases; commonly used ones include MySQL, PostgreSQL, and MongoDB.
5. Version Control/Git:
- Develop proficiency in using version control systems like Git.
6. Build and Deployment:
- Gain an understanding of deploying a website and learn about tools like Webpack.
7. Learn about APIs:
- Understand how to consume APIs and build your own.
8. Security:
- Acquire knowledge about web security best practices.
9. Practice:
- Build projects to apply your skills and showcase them in a portfolio.
10. Stay Updated:
- Keep abreast of the evolving web development landscape by learning about new technologies and trends.
11. Networking:
- Connect with other developers, join communities, and participate in meetups or conferences.
12. Soft Skills:
- Develop communication and problem-solving skills; learn how to work effectively in a team.
13. Online Courses and Resources:
- Utilize online platforms like Udemy, Coursera, or free resources such as MDN Web Docs.
Remember this jobs need very hard work and dedication.
ADVANTAGES OF BECOMING WEB DEVELOPER:-
Becoming a web developer has numerous advantages:
1. Abundant Job Opportunities: The demand for web developers is high, providing ample job prospects.
2. Flexible Work Locations: Web developers often enjoy the flexibility of working from different locations.
3. Creative Expression: The role allows for creative expression through the creation of visually appealing and user-friendly websites.
4. Continuous Learning: Web development is dynamic, requiring ongoing learning and adaptation to new technologies.
5. Entrepreneurial Opportunities: Web developers can explore entrepreneurial ventures by creating their own online projects.
6. Competitive Compensation: Skilled web developers often receive competitive salaries due to their sought-after expertise.
7. Global Impact: Websites and applications developed can have a global reach, reaching users worldwide.
8. Collaborative Work: Web development often involves collaborative efforts, fostering teamwork and shared accomplishments.
9. Innovation: The field is known for rapid innovation, providing opportunities to work with cutting-edge technologies and frameworks.
10. Problem-Solving Skills: Web developers enhance their problem-solving skills by addressing coding challenges and optimizing website performance.
11. Portfolio Showcase: Building a strong portfolio allows developers to showcase their skills and attract potential employers or clients.
12. Engagement with Community: Web developers can engage with a vibrant online community, participating in forums, conferences, and meetups to share knowledge and stay informed about industry trends.
SOME QUESTION AND ANSWER RELATED THIS TOPIC:--
Ques:-what is the work of web developer?
Ans:-Web developer create and maintain Websites.
Ques:-is web development is good carrer?
Ans:-Yes, it is.
Ques:-is web development is easy?
Ans:-It's not easy but also not much hard.
Ques:-will web development become good job in future?
Ans:-Absolutely, yes.